okay i read the first half of this thread and had to chime in with my personal opinion.

TES and Recovery are by far my favorite 2 eminem albums and i really do believe that they both go down in history as classics. MMLP will probably do the same because of all the love for it that i see.. that album was different than all other hip hop albums at the time and it defined eminems career basically so i guess it could be considered classic for those reasons, although its my 4TH favorite (yes 4th) eminem album. SSLP is the most iffy one in my eyes. but it had a couple big hits and a lot more of the album was great after listening to it. it was his first album and i doubt its going to receive as much credit as deserved but thats just me. but that album obviously put em on the map.

so all in all from his albums currently out....... he has 3-4 that will go down as classics.
